What Are Communicable Diseases?

Communicable diseases, also known as infectious diseases, are illnesses caused by pathogens such as bacteria, viruses, fungi, and parasites. These diseases can spread within communities quickly if proper hygiene and preventive measures are not observed. Some of the most familiar communicable diseases include the common cold, influenza, tuberculosis, and chickenpox.

Modes of Transmission

Communicable diseases spread through several primary routes:

  • Direct Contact: Touching an infected person, including handshakes, hugs, or sexual contact.
  • Indirect Contact: Touching surfaces or objects contaminated with pathogens.
  • Droplet Transmission: Coughing, sneezing, or talking releases droplets that carry infectious agents.
  • Airborne Transmission: Some pathogens can remain suspended in the air and infect others when inhaled.
  • Vector-borne: Transmission through insects like mosquitoes or ticks.

Common Communicable Diseases

1. Influenza (Flu)

Influenza, commonly known as the flu, is a viral infection that affects the respiratory system. It is highly contagious and spreads through droplets when an infected person coughs or sneezes. Symptoms include fever, chills, muscle aches, fatigue, and respiratory issues. Vaccination is the most effective way to prevent the flu.

2. Tuberculosis (TB)

Tuberculosis is caused by the bacterium Mycobacterium tuberculosis and primarily affects the lungs. It spreads through the air when an infected person coughs or sneezes. Symptoms include persistent cough, weight loss, fever, and night sweats. Treatment involves a combination of antibiotics taken over several months.

3. Malaria

Malaria is a parasitic disease transmitted through the bite of infected female Anopheles mosquitoes. It is prevalent in tropical and subtropical regions. Symptoms include fever, chills, headache, and vomiting. Prevention includes using insect repellents, sleeping under mosquito nets, and taking antimalarial medications.

4. HIV/AIDS

HIV (Human Immunodeficiency Virus) attacks the immune system, leading to AIDS (Acquired Immunodeficiency Syndrome) if left untreated. It spreads through bodily fluids such as blood, semen, and vaginal fluids. Symptoms include fatigue, weight loss, and frequent infections. Antiretroviral therapy (ART) is used to manage the condition.

5. Hepatitis

Hepatitis is inflammation of the liver caused by various viruses, including Hepatitis A, B, and C. It spreads through contaminated food and water (Hepatitis A), bodily fluids (Hepatitis B), and blood-to-blood contact (Hepatitis C). Symptoms include jaundice, fatigue, and abdominal pain. Vaccination and safe practices can prevent hepatitis.

Transmission and Pathogenesis

The pathogens responsible for common communicable diseases employ diverse transmission strategies, adapting to their environments for maximum spread. For example, tuberculosis bacteria can survive airborne in droplets, making crowded and poorly ventilated spaces high-risk zones. Viral agents like influenza mutate frequently, complicating vaccine development and necessitating annual immunization efforts.

The Historical Context of Communicable Diseases

Throughout history, communicable diseases have shaped human societies. The Black Death in the 14th century, caused by the bacterium Yersinia pestis, resulted in the deaths of millions of people in Europe and Asia. Similarly, the 1918 influenza pandemic, known as the Spanish flu, infected an estimated 500 million people worldwide, leading to significant mortality rates. These historical events highlight the devastating impact of communicable diseases on human populations.
